Management of Acute Renal Failure with Volume Overload
This chapter discusses the speaker's approach to managing a patient with congestive heart failure and acute renal failure, including the use of nitroglycerin, furosemide, and improvised methods for ventilation. The chapter also highlights the challenges of managing hyperkalemia and concerns about the patient's survival during transport.
